[PATCH] D49109: Borrow visibility from __fundamental_type_info for generated fundamental type infos

2018-07-19 Thread Peter Collingbourne via Phabricator via cfe-commits
pcc added a subscriber: cfe-commits. pcc added inline comments. Comment at: lib/CodeGen/ItaniumCXXABI.cpp:3215 // Emit the standard library with external linkage. llvm::GlobalVariable::LinkageTypes Linkage; if (IsStdLib) `IsStdLib` will always be false a

[PATCH] D49109: Borrow visibility from __fundamental_type_info for generated fundamental type infos

2018-07-19 Thread Tom Anderson via Phabricator via cfe-commits
thomasanderson updated this revision to Diff 156399. thomasanderson marked 5 inline comments as done. https://reviews.llvm.org/D49109 Files: lib/CodeGen/ItaniumCXXABI.cpp Index: lib/CodeGen/ItaniumCXXABI.cpp === --- lib/CodeGen/It

[PATCH] D49109: Borrow visibility from __fundamental_type_info for generated fundamental type infos

2018-07-19 Thread Peter Collingbourne via Phabricator via cfe-commits
pcc accepted this revision. pcc added a comment. This revision is now accepted and ready to land. LGTM https://reviews.llvm.org/D49109 ___ cfe-commits mailing list cfe-commits@lists.llvm.org http://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its

[PATCH] D49109: Borrow visibility from __fundamental_type_info for generated fundamental type infos

2018-07-19 Thread Peter Collingbourne via Phabricator via cfe-commits
pcc requested changes to this revision. pcc added a comment. This revision now requires changes to proceed. Sorry, I noticed that this patch is missing a test case. Can you add one please? https://reviews.llvm.org/D49109 ___ cfe-commits mailing list

[PATCH] D49109: Borrow visibility from __fundamental_type_info for generated fundamental type infos

2018-07-23 Thread Tom Anderson via Phabricator via cfe-commits
thomasanderson updated this revision to Diff 156943. thomasanderson added a comment. Added test. Also verified that all tests in llvm/tools/clang/test pass. https://reviews.llvm.org/D49109 Files: lib/CodeGen/ItaniumCXXABI.cpp test/CodeGenCXX/rtti-fundamental.cpp Index: test/CodeGenCXX/rtt

[PATCH] D49109: Borrow visibility from __fundamental_type_info for generated fundamental type infos

2018-07-23 Thread Peter Collingbourne via Phabricator via cfe-commits
pcc accepted this revision. pcc added a comment. This revision is now accepted and ready to land. LGTM https://reviews.llvm.org/D49109 ___ cfe-commits mailing list cfe-commits@lists.llvm.org http://lists.llvm.org/cgi-bin/mailman/listinfo/cfe-commits

[PATCH] D49109: Borrow visibility from __fundamental_type_info for generated fundamental type infos

2018-07-23 Thread Tom Anderson via Phabricator via cfe-commits
This revision was automatically updated to reflect the committed changes. Closed by commit rC337788: Borrow visibility from __fundamental_type_info for generated fundamental type… (authored by thomasanderson, committed by ). Repository: rC Clang https://reviews.llvm.org/D49109 Files: lib/Co